What Is an NFC Bracelet Payment System?
An NFC (Near Field Communication) bracelet payment system is a contactless solution that embeds a small NFC chip into a wearable band—typically made of silicone, fabric, or plastic. This chip stores encrypted user data, such as identity credentials, room numbers, ride tickets, or digital wallet balances.
When tapped against an NFC-enabled reader (like those at hotel room doors, food kiosks, or attraction entrances), the bracelet communicates wirelessly over short distances (usually <4 cm) to authenticate and process transactions instantly—no PIN, no card, no phone required.
Unlike traditional RFID systems used only for access control, modern NFC bracelets support secure, two-way communication, enabling dynamic updates like balance top-ups, loyalty point accrual, or even personalized offers pushed directly to the guest’s profile.

NFC vs. Traditional RFID: What’s the Difference?
Many confuse NFC with standard RFID. While both use radio waves, they serve different purposes:
| Feature | NFC (Near Field Communication) | Traditional RFID (HF/UHF) |
|---|---|---|
| Communication | Two-way (read + write) | Mostly one-way (read-only) |
| Range | Up to 4 cm | HF: ~1m; UHF: up to 12m |
| Security | High (supports encryption, authentication) | Low to moderate |
| Smartphone Compatibility | Yes (most modern phones have NFC) | No (requires dedicated reader) |
| Use Case | Payments, secure access, data exchange | Inventory, asset tracking, basic access |
| Cost per Unit | Slightly higher | Lower |
For cashless payment applications, NFC is the clear winner due to its security, interoperability, and ability to update data dynamically (e.g., deducting $10 after a meal).
Key Features to Look for in an NFC Bracelet System
Not all NFC solutions are created equal. When evaluating vendors, prioritize these capabilities:
✅ Multi-Application Support
Your system should handle access control, cashless payments, loyalty programs, and event check-ins on a single band—no need for multiple wearables.
✅ Offline Transaction Capability
Readers should process payments even during internet outages, syncing data once connectivity resumes. Critical for remote parks or basements with poor signal.
✅ Cloud-Based Management Platform
A centralized dashboard lets you:
- Monitor real-time sales and foot traffic
- Remotely deactivate lost bands
- Push promotions or alerts
- Generate financial and behavioral reports

Common Pitfalls to Avoid
Even well-planned projects can stumble. Watch out for these mistakes:
🚫 Ignoring Guest Onboarding
If guests don’t understand how to use the band, adoption fails. Provide clear instructions at check-in and visual cues at readers.
🚫 Underestimating Band Durability Needs
Water parks need waterproof silicone; kids’ camps need tear-resistant materials. Choose housing based on environment.
🚫 Skipping Offline Mode Testing
Internet outages happen. Ensure your readers can still process payments and sync later.
🚫 Overlooking Data Privacy
Comply with GDPR, CCPA, or local regulations. Never store sensitive financial data on the band—use tokenization instead.
